"Putin's People" by Catherine Belton offers a gripping and detailed account of Vladimir Putin's rise to power and the inner workings of his administration. This audiobook summary distills key insights from Belton's thorough research, presenting a clear picture of the complex political landscape in Russia under Putin's rule.

The book is structured into ten chapters, each focusing on different aspects of Putin's regime. It starts by introducing the concept of the "siloviki," a group of individuals from the security services, known for their authoritarian tendencies, who have been instrumental in Putin's ascent. The narrative then delves into the history of the KGB and its successor, the FSB, examining their profound influence on Putin’s worldview and policies.

A significant portion of the book is dedicated to exploring the intricate relationship between Putin and the oligarchs. It examines how oligarchs played a crucial role in Putin's rise to power and how their influence continues to shape Russia's economy and politics. The book also sheds light on the "chekists," detailing their role in Soviet history and their impact on current policies.

Belton's work also explores the various strategies employed by Putin to consolidate power. This includes his takeover of media and the oil industry, the utilization of terrorism to strengthen his public image, and the creation of a slush fund for enriching his inner circle and funding operations abroad. The book also touches upon Russia's geopolitical maneuvers, including its actions in Ukraine and the annexation of Crimea.
